Grim Woods is a 2017 Canadian horror anthology film about four counsellors telling campfire stories at a remote summer camp.

Produced and directed by Ryan Byrne and Danial O’Brien (All Hallows Eve: October 30th) from a screenplay co-written with Hannah Craig.

Plot:
Ignoring all signs and warnings, four counsellors at remote summer camp Elmwood tell campfire stories to each other from an ancient book of evil that come to life to haunt them one by one…

Grim Woods is grim indeed, a disappointing effort at a retro-styled horror flick that seems like it wants to go the way of ’80s horror yet sets itself within a book of ancient tales that somehow contains surprisingly contemporary stories like the film’s first story involving a babysitter and a seemingly sadistic clown. The acting is abysmal across the board…” The Independent Critic
